Definition of Accredited Online Colleges:   

Accredited online colleges are institutions that have been evaluated  and approved by recognized accreditation agencies. These agencies assess various aspects of an institution, including faculty qualifications, curriculum, student support services, and resources, to determine if they meet established quality standards. Accreditation can be regional, national, or program-specific, and it serves as an assurance that the education provided by the institution is credible and of high quality.

Importance of Accreditation in Online Education:   

Accreditation is crucial in online education for several reasons. Firstly, it ensures that the institution meets specific quality standards and provides a credible and recognized education. Accreditation also allows students to access federal financial aid, including grants and loans, which can significantly reduce the cost of education. Additionally, accreditation facilitates the transferability of credits earned from one institution to another, making it easier for students to continue their education or pursue advanced degrees. Moreover, accreditation enhances job prospects as many employers prefer to hire candidates with degrees from accredited institutions.

Flexibility in Scheduling:   

One of the primary advantages of online schools is the flexibility in scheduling. Unlike traditional schools, which often follow rigid schedules, online schools allow learners to access their coursework and assignments at their own pace and convenience. This flexibility is especially beneficial for students who may have other commitments, such as part-time jobs, family responsibilities, or extracurricular activities. Learners can design their own study schedules, which provides them with the freedom to balance their education with other aspects of their lives.   

Lower Costs:   

Another significant advantage of online schools is the potential for lower costs compared to traditional schools. Traditional schools often come with substantial expenses, including tuition fees, commuting costs, housing, and meal plans. On the other hand, online schools eliminate many of these expenses. Learners can save on commuting costs as they can study from home or any location with internet access. Online programs also tend to have lower tuition fees compared to traditional schools, making education more affordable and accessible to a wider audience
